Job Description:
The Binghamton University Office of Entrepreneurship and Innovation Partnerships (EIP) manages intellectual property rights and technology transfer activities for Binghamton University, including technology licensing, business incubation, entrepreneurship training, creation of start ups, and innovation initiatives. The Senior Technology Transfer Associate is a key member of the Technology Transfer Office, responsible for advancing Binghamton's intellectual assets from intake through assessment to intellectual property protection, marketing, licensing, and commercialization. The role includes supporting the launch and growth of university spinout companies, including through campus and partner technology commercialization and business incubation resources.Responsibilities include:
Work with campus inventors to encourage and facilitate submission of New Technology Disclosures Assess inventions and creative works for their potential for patenting or copyright protection and for licensing to commercial partners; design and support commercialization pathways, including through campus spinout companies. Advise and educate Binghamton creators regarding intellectual property law, funding agency regulations, and SUNY policies as they apply to ownership, revenue sharing, and management of conflicts of interest Prepare marketing materials and undertake campaigns to present inventions, software, and creative works to potential company commercialization partners Coordinate inventors in working with RF SUNY and outside counsel on patent filings and copyright registrations Guide faculty, staff, and students to resources helpful in translating and commercializing their inventions and in launching spinouts, including through support from institutional, state, and federal grant programs, as well as university and external technology commercialization and business incubation resources Participate in deploying and delivering programs designed for educating and supporting university inventors in the process of technology translation and commercialization Build and foster relationships with corporate business development teams Draft and negotiate agreements, e.g., options and licenses, nondisclosure, material transfer, intellectual property, and inter-institutional agreements Manage caseload through docketing database (Minuet by Inteum), and utilize additional database platforms as appropriate Assist the University's Division of Research relative to compliance function, e.g., in making reports of inventions to government and industry sponsors of research Contribute to funding proposals and implementation of grants awardedRequirements:
